How Solar Refrigerators Work
Comprehending exactly how solar refrigerators run is necessary for appreciating their advantages. At the core of solar refrigeration is the solar (PV) system, which transforms sunlight into power. This electrical energy powers the compressor, an essential component that flows refrigerant through the system. The cooling agent absorbs warmth from the interior of the fridge and dissipates it outside, therefore cooling the inner setting.
Solar refrigerators normally include a battery storage space system to ensure capability during durations of reduced sunlight or nighttime. When sunshine is abundant, the PV panels produce electricity to run the compressor and bill the batteries. The kept power can then be used when solar power is inadequate, keeping a consistent temperature level inside the fridge.
Numerous solar fridges additionally incorporate energy-efficient elements, such as LED lights and high-performance insulation, to reduce power intake. Applications in Off-Grid Locations
In many off-grid locations, solar fridges function as a crucial resource for protecting food and medicine, considerably enhancing the high quality of life for neighborhoods lacking access to trusted power. These cutting-edge devices harness solar power to preserve ideal temperatures, crucial for preventing food spoilage and keeping the effectiveness of medications.
In remote regions, where standard refrigeration alternatives are commonly unwise or unavailable, solar fridges use a sustainable solution. They make it possible for regional farmers to store perishable fruit and vegetables, therefore reducing waste and boosting food safety and security. Additionally, in medical care settings, solar refrigerators make sure that vaccines and essential medicines remain sensible, adding to better wellness outcomes for populaces that might or else face substantial barriers to medical care gain access to.
